Transaction 66c53a66f7dcb48e3dfad1f5ddf58334e331619e8c56856687bacd8268994337
1 Input
1 Output
-
66c53a66f7dcb48e3dfad1f5ddf58334e331619e8c56856687bacd8268994337:0
- value
- 339866
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 03761e6d8fdee1db425db10424d9f60e9af35664 OP_EQUAL
- address
- 321KTAKRqvRuaR4m7iEhPhd3mKD7To7Det